CITY OF NORTH OLMSTED <br />ORDINANCE NO. 2026 - 58 <br />By: Mayor Jones <br />AN ORDINANCE AUTHORIZING THE MAYOR TO ACCEPT ON <br />BEHALF OF THE CITY OF NORTH OLMSTED THE NORTHEAST <br />OHIO PUBLIC ENERGY COUNCIL C'NOPEC'9 2026 ENERGIZED <br />COMMUNITY GRANT, AND DECLARING AN EMERGENCY <br />WHEREAS, the City of North Olmsted, Ohio ("City") is a member of the Northeast Ohio <br />Public Energy Council ("NOPEC") and is eligible for one or more NOPEC Energized Community <br />Grants for 2026 ("NEC Grants") as provided for in the NEC Grant Program guidelines; and <br />WHEREAS, the City wishes to enter into a Grant Agreement with NOPEC in <br />substantially the form presented to this Council to receive one or more NEC Grants. <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F <br />NORTH OLMSTED, COUNTY OF CUYAHOGA, AND STATE OF OHIO, THAT. <br />SECTION 1: This Council finds and determines that it is in the best interest of the City <br />to enter into the Grant Agreement to accept the NEC Grants for 2026, and authorizes the Mayor to <br />execute the Grant Agreement and all other documents necessary to accept the NEC Grant funds. See <br />Grant Agreement attached hereto. <br />SECTION 2: This Council finds and determines that all formal actions of this Council <br />concerning and relating to the adoption of this Ordinance were taken in an open meeting of this <br />Council and that all deliberations of this Council and any committees that resulted in those formal <br />actions were in meetings open to the public in compliance with the law. <br />SECTION 3: That this Resolution is hereby declared to be an emergency measure <br />immediately necessary for the preservation of the public health, safety and welfare and for the further <br />reason that immediate authorization is required given that the deadline to accept the grant funds has <br />expired and already has been extended one time; and further provided that it receives the affirmative <br />vote of two-thirds of all members of Council, it shall take effect and be in force immediately upon its <br />passage and approval by the Mayor. <br />PASSED: <br />First Reading: �-- <br />Second Reading: Su S,pc.��GCtq� <br />Third Reading:c4 <br />Committee: <br />
